How far people went at school, the qualifications they hold and what they studied.
Education levels in Goolgowi have remained low compared to other regions, with only 31.4% of residents completing Year 12. This is far below the New South Wales figure of 58.9%. Most adults here hold certificates rather than degrees, reflecting a local workforce focused on practical skills.
Highest year of school completed.
Only 31.4% of people finished Year 12, which is far below the national figure of 58.8%. Around 30.5% of residents stopped at Year 10, while 17.9% left school in Year 9 or earlier.

Post-school qualifications and degrees.
Just 6.4% of adults hold a bachelor degree or higher, far below the New South Wales rate of 27.8%. The most common qualification is a Certificate III or IV, held by 38.6% of the community.

What people studied.
People with qualifications in Goolgowi most often studied management and commerce (16.4%), engineering (13.5%), or agriculture and the environment (12.9%).
Schools in the area and how many children they serve (ACARA).
The area has one government primary school, which is much smaller than most others with an average size of 38 students. While there are 13.33 schools per 1,000 children, the school advantage score is much lower than in most areas.
